Il faut bien attaquer le langage VBA quelque part. Alors, nous allons partir sur des choses simples. Si vous connaissez déjà un autre langage de programmation, votre apprentissage en sera d’autant facilité. Dans le cas contraire, n’ayez crainte, vous vous en sortirez haut la main !
Commentaires
Les commentaires tout d’abord. Peut-être avez-vous remarqué les lignes en vert dans la macro DateLongue → Lire la suite
- RAM et ROM Les systèmes nécessitent des unités de stockage, que ce soit à court ou à long terme. Les systèmes informatiques tirent parti des systèmes de mémoire dont ils disposent, qu'il s'agisse de mémoire vive (RAM), de mémoire d'accès en lecture seule (ROM) et d'unités de stockage très denses comme les disques durs. Vous vous demandez peut-être pourquoi nous ne pouvons pas avoir une unité de stockage pour tous. Pour faire simple, c'est parce que chaque système est spécialement conçu pour fonctionner efficacement pour sa fonction plutôt que pour exécuter toutes les fonctions que vous désirez. Prenons cet article comme un exemple de la…
- Gestion de la mémoire Qu'est-ce que la gestion de la mémoire? La gestion de la mémoire est une activité effectuée dans le noyau du système d'exploitation. Le noyau lui-même est la partie centrale d'un système d'exploitation, il gère les opérations de l'ordinateur et de son matériel, mais il est surtout connu pour gérer la mémoire et le temps CPU. L'une des fonctions clés du système de gestion de mémoire dans un ordinateur est l'affectation de mémoire à un certain nombre de programmes en cours d'exécution différents pour maintenir les performances du système stables. La mémoire dans le système est allouée dynamiquement en fonction des besoins,…
- VBA Excel – Le modèle objet d’Excel Si vous avez déjà côtoyé un langage de programmation objet, vous aurez certainement compris en lisant l’article précédent que les éléments manipulés dans Excel sont des objets. Les principaux objets Excel Si vous n’avez jamais approché de près ou de loin un langage objet, vous n’avez certainement aucune idée de ce qu’est un langage objet, ni comment le fait que le VBA soit un langage objet va impacter votre programmation. Eh bien, disons qu’Excel consiste en un ensemble de briques que nous appellerons « objets ». Par exemple, les classeurs, les feuilles de calcul, les plages et les cellules sont des objets Excel.…
- VBA Excel – Introduction au VBA Qu’est-ce que VBA ? VBA est l’abréviation de Visual Basic for Applications. Comme son nom l’indique, VBA est issu du langage Visual Basic de Microsoft. Le “A” de VBA désigne les applications de la suite Office. Essentiellement Word, Excel, PowerPoint et Outlook. En utilisant VBA, vous pourrez donc automatiser certaines tâches dans les applications Office. Cette formation s’intéresse avant tout à l’utilisation de VBA dans Excel, mais les principes abordés s’appliquent (sauf lorsqu’ils sont trop spécifiques) aux autres applications de la suite → Lire la suite
- VBA Excel – Une première macro Excel Définition d’une première macro A titre d’exemple, nous allons définir une macro qui met en en forme des dates. Avant de sélectionner l’onglet Développeur et de cliquer sur l’icône Enregistrer une macro dans le groupe Code, sélectionnez les cellules dont le format doit être changé → Lire la suite
- Quel langage de programmation devrais-je apprendre en… Donc, vous voulez apprendre la programmation. Peut-être avez-vous demandé à vos amis développeurs des recommandations et des réponses différentes. Ils ont expliqué avec des termes que vous ne comprenez pas (qu’est-ce qui est orienté objet?!). Pour vous aider à choisir votre premier langage de programmation à apprendre, voici un infographie facile à comprendre qui recommande la meilleure option, en fonction de vos objectifs et de vos intérêts. Des détails tels que les difficultés d’apprentissage, la popularité et le salaire moyen pour chaque langage de programmation informatique sont également fournis → Lire la suite
- VBA Excel – Affecter une macro à un bouton dans la barre… Pour accéder facilement à une macro, vous pouvez lui affecter une icône dans la barre d’outils Accès rapide. Lancez la commande Options dans le menu Fichier. La boîte de dialogue Options Excel s’affiche. Sélectionnez Barre d’outils Accès rapide dans la partie gauche de la boîte de dialogue. Sélectionnez Macros dans la liste déroulante Choisir les commandes dans les catégories suivantes . Cliquez sur la macro dans la zone de liste inférieure, puis cliquez sur Ajouter → Lire la suite
- Google pourrait ajouter la télémétrie au langage de… Google est une nouvelle fois au cœur d’une controverse sur la protection de la vie privée, avec une proposition visant à ajouter la télémétrie au langage de programmation Go. Go est un langage de programmation développé par Google. Bien qu’analogue au langage C, il apporte un certain nombre d’ajouts importants et modernes. Russ Cox est […] L’article Google pourrait ajouter la télémétrie au langage de programmation Go est apparu en premier sur BlogNT : le Blog des Nouvelles Technologies. Source
- VBA Excel – Avant de commencer Excel est très pratique pour réaliser des documents sous la forme de tableaux : des bulletins de paie, des devis et des factures, par exemple. Il permet également de créer des études prévisionnelles, d’analyser et de synthétiser des données. Parfois, il n’existe aucune fonctionnalité prédéfinie dans Excel pour répondre à un besoin particulier. Vous devez alors “programmer Excel” pour créer cette fonctionnalité. Pour cela, vous pouvez passer par l’enregistreur de macros ou par le langage VBA. Cette formation va vous apprendre à utiliser l’un comme l’autre. Aucune connaissance en programmation n’est nécessaire. Par contre, vous devez avoir déjà pratiqué Excel →…
- VBA Excel – Procédures Lorsque vous définissez une macro avec l’enregistreur de macros, Excel crée une procédure, lui donne le nom de la macro et la stocke dans le module attaché au classeur. Nous allons vérifier que l’inverse est également vrai. En d’autres termes, que si vous définissez une procédure en VBA, elle est accessible sous la forme d’une macro→ Lire la suite